How to Improve Your English Pronunciation
Accurate pronunciation is an important part of learning English, or any language for that matter. The way your speech sounds can have a big impact on whether or not people understand what you are saying and their initial impression of you. There are no shortcuts to perfect pronunciation; there are, however, some ways you can practice more effectively and improve your skills faster.
It’s often difficult to hear pronunciation errors in your own speech because you are concentrating on actually communicating rather than the sound you are making. If you can’t hear your pronunciation problems, it’s tough to correct them. Try recording your speech with your smartphone or PC and making a note of specific areas you need to improve on.
Moreover, many English learners think that speaking fluently means they need to speak fast. This is wrong. Speaking too fast reinforces bad habits and makes the speaker sound nervous and indecisive. Speaking slowly will give you time to breathe properly and think about what you want to say next.
Pronunciation is a physical skill. You’re teaching your mouth a new way to move and using different muscles. Focus on difficult sounds each day. Having trouble with “th”? Put your tongue between your teeth (don’t bite down) and blow air out of your mouth. Feel the air move over the top of your tongue. Another method worth a try is learning popular English songs. Singing helps you relax and just get those words out, as well as helping your rhythm and intonation (语调). Because you don’t need to concentrate on constructing sentences for yourself, you can concentrate on making your pronunciation sound great!

Reading classic literature 1.(write)by native speakers can improve your English language skills in several ways.2.,this will not happen by magic:only if you read the book 3.(careful)and think about what you are reading.First,if you concentrate hard,you will not only 4.(large)your vocabulary,but also begin to appreciate slight differences in meaning between words.Second,5.you examine the language attentively,you can learn to appreciate different English writing 6.(style).The light and ironic style of Jane Austen is quite different from 7.serious and intense style of Charlotte Bronte though both of them are great writers of English.
Sometimes it is necessary to read a book more than once in order to absorb 8.(it)full benefit.Read it once 9.(understand)the story,once again to appreciate the way the characters are described and the story develops and finally to become really familiar 10.the new vocabulary and expressions.Above all,enjoy the stories.Happy reading!
